
Vault City Classic Neapolitan Single Scoop
Style: Fruit and chocolate pastry sour
Producer: Vault City
Origin: Scotland
Size: 44cl
Alcohol: 4.1%
Price: 35kr
Systembolaget: 1031434 (sold out)
Vault City Brewing is a modern craft brewery based in Portobello, Edinburgh, founded in 2018 and best known for its bold, fruit-forward sour beers. The brewery quickly gained attention for pushing flavour intensity, often using large amounts of real fruit and experimenting with pastry-inspired concepts, and are regarded as one of the UK’s leading sour beer specialists. This has been flavoured with chocolate and lactose has been added to give extra body and smoothness. Did this live up to the high standard of this amazing brewery though? It absolutely did!
This had a dull orange to red colour with a very thick haze. A creamy bubble bath style head formed on the beer and held for a long time. The aroma exploded from the glass and gave massive strawberry jam notes. Vanilla and a hint of blackberry followed through as well as minor notes. The creamy, thick mouthfeel coated the palate perfectly, letting the flavours evolve. Slightly unripe strawberry hit the tongue first then transitioned into a strawberry jam note after swallowing. The malts were not overlooked and helped support the fruity tones. The chocolate unfortunately is too light to be noticed, but the sweet vanilla is present throughout. The aftertaste was medium, with the red fruit clinging to the back of the palate with a low acidity.
This was an absolutely amazing sour, burst with life. Aroma, taste and body were all big and enticing, working in harmony with each other. I would have liked a bit more chocolate in the taste but that was only a minor note. This was another banger from Vault City, and I look forward to seeing what else they will create soon.
